Pedestrian Dies After Crash At Penrith 5 June

A woman has died following a crash in Sydney's west.

About 5.30pm today (Thursday 5 June 2025), emergency services were called to Macquarie Avenue, Penrith, following reports a ute had allegedly struck a pedestrian before driving away from the scene without stopping.

A woman – believed to be aged in her 40's – was treated by NSW Ambulance paramedics; however, she died at the scene.

She is yet to be formally identified.

Officers attached to Nepean Police Area Command established a crime scene which will be forensically examined by investigators from the Crash Investigation Unit.

A report will be prepared for the information of the Coroner.

Anyone with information or dashcam footage is urged to contact Nepean police or Crime Stoppers on 1800 333 000.
